    Matt went on to be quite succesful as a producer. After the C64 music he went on to write and produce his own dance music on an independant label. He DJ'd for a bit in clubs. He was a part of Motiv8 whose most famous track was Rockin For Myself. He's worked on remixes for Pulp (Disco 2000). Later on he was part of the production company who won an Ivor Novello award for Cher - I Believe. He is still working as a producer today. He still doesnt wear a belt.

    As the C64 was dying, Jon Wells was out there trying to save it.
    This was one of Jon's big efforts to try and save the scene, and bring one final Last Ninja to the C64.
    Jon created a series of demos, and music was created to try and convince System 3 that they could make one final game in the series.
    Jon was planning to allow the Ninja to interact more with the background of the game, and be able to walk on the grass. .
